Smokey Says Today's Fire Danger is

Fire Danger at this location based on local conditions.

Note that since this station is close to Lake Huron, temperatures can be lower and humidities can be higher than further inland. Fire conditions can vary greatly even a few miles away.

High Moisture Limitations: With PM2.5 sensors, fog reflects the light, and can result in a higher reading. This is characteristic to the inherent sensor design. The condition occurs during rainy or foggy weather, where: Outdoor Temperature - Dew point Temperature ≤ 2 ℃ 3.6 ℉
